Currently, skiers and snowboards alike would take the lifts to the top of Whistler mountain, and ski or board across the mountain to get to Blackcomb, or alternatively pick one of the chair lifts starting at the base of the resorts Whistler Village that lead up Whistler mountain or Blackcomb mountain.

Whistler officials expect the gondola will become a marketing icon, a lift that will help sustain the resort’s image in the travel industry and marketplace.

Construction of the Whistler Blackcomb gondola comes after a period when hotel tax revenue - a key economic indicator in Whistler - has been stagnant or declined. Whistler has enjoyed great snowfalls during the past two years, but the high Canadian dollar and competition from American resorts continue to pose a problem.
The Peak to Peak Gondola in Whistler Blackcomb will help attract enough visitors to sustain Whistler’s hotel industry and its retail sector, said Brownlie.

The giant lift will also help the resort cope with the effects of global warming decades down the road, Brownlie said, by letting skiers who are visiting on their vacation bypass low-snow zones to get into the high alpine.

The gondola will also break world records, say Whistler officials.

The installation of lift tower 3 on Blackcomb has been completed and lift tower 2 on Whistler is expected to be finished by the end of October. Two other towers are scheduled to be built in 2008 so the gondola is ready for the 2008-2009 ski season.

Melamed acknowledged that some Whistler residents fear the gondola will mar the mountain view from the valley.

“But I think people will get used to it. It won’t obliterate the view by any stretch.”
Michel Beaudry, a ski industry consultant and author of the history of Whistler Against All Odds, believes the gondola is aimed at boosting the non-skiing sight-seeing market.
